A tidal bore (or just bore, or eagre) is a tidal phenomenon in which the leading edge of the incoming tide forms a wave (or waves) of water that travel up a river or narrow bay against the direction of the current. As such, it is a true tidal wave (not to be confused with a tsunami).

Bores occur in relatively few locations worldwide, usually in areas with a large tidal range, and where incoming tides are funnelled into a shallow, narrowing river via a broad bay.

Bores take on various forms, ranging from a single breaking wavefront—effectively a shock wave—to ‘undular bores’ comprising a smooth wavefront followed by a train of solitary waves (solitons). Larger bores can be particularly dangerous for shipping, but also present a challenge to surfers.

The word bore derives through Old English from the Old Norse word bara, meaning a wave or swell.
